Re: Retirement of the Stonebriar product line

Stonebriar sales have declined for five consecutive quarters and support costs now exceed contribution margin. The retirement plan is staged: new orders close end of Q2, existing contracts honoured through their terms, and spares stocked for twenty-four months. Sales leads should steer prospects toward the Ashgrove range; migration incentives are already approved. Customer comms are drafted and awaiting legal sign-off. The forward strategy behind this decision is set out in the note below.

confidential, yafog-hagug: Gross margin on Druix came in at 10 percent against a plan of 15 percent. Only 5 of the 80 pilot accounts renewed Druix, so a churn review is set for October 1.

# Settings for the Quillport print-spooler microservice.
# Jobs are queued per-tenant; the spooler polls every five seconds
# and retries failed renders three times before parking them.
# Do not change the polling interval without approval from the
# platform team. The job-state tables live in the spooler database,
# reachable via the connection string below.

replica DSN, kajep-yahag: mssql://praok_svc:iF@db-8d68.plorvaio.local:5432/eliion

v5.2.0 — Corvid Dedupe pipeline. We renamed DEDUP_STRICT to MATCH_CONFIDENCE_MIN because the old boolean hid the actual threshold logic; the new setting takes a value from 0 to 100, and we default to 85. For the new contractor: the old key still works until v5.4 but logs a deprecation warning, so please update any env files you touch. The merge service also authenticates against the records store, and that credential should be added on the line immediately following this entry.

vault entry, yahaf-tagug: LEDGER_TOKEN20=884d77d1a8b98aa4edfb

# Gridwright Generator: Limits & Quotas

The crossword generator will happily chew CPU forever if you let it, so we don't. Each fill attempt gets a bounded search budget, grids over a certain size route to the slow queue, and per-user daily generation is capped to keep the word-list service happy. Bump these carefully — the backtracker's runtime is very nonlinear. Current caps and budgets are set below.

limits module of fajog-tawig:
RATE_LIMITS = {
    "druwyn": 2,
    "quenael": 10,
    "wenix": 2,
    "druael": 2,
}